Miles (the youngest brother) and Roxy's story.  He has a young son and was burned before.  She is pregnant and doing it alone.  Being each other's plus ones for events and getting to know one another has Miles falling hard.  Skittish with a bad dating track record has Roxy falling and pulling back.  With a little help from family has the two of them wrapped in a fast paced insta-love interesting romance. Blakely always weaves a good tale.

My favorite of the series! I swooned over Miles Hart and his son Ben (who had the best lines- Chicken magnet!) and Roxy was just plain cool. I loved watching their friendship develop along with their fake relationship- they had such great chemistry but it was a nice slow burn. Andi Arndt and Sebastian York are perennial favorites and they did an excellent job as usual. Blakely always adds extra treats in her audiobooks, and the Little Big Rock bonus was fun.
